    Default Fall time Crappie fishing tips


    I would like to put together a list of fall time crappie fishing tips, tricks, and what to look for with changing water conditions.

    With the limited amount of experience I have I starting by looking for the shad around the mouths of creek arms and hitting the first brush I see. Most of the time I use a 1/8 oz jig with a stand out wire hook above it. I have had a lot of luck with this so far.

    I also have put in a fare amount of time shooting docks and have started to get an eye of what to look for. I am looking for the dock that the true fisherman owns with structure all around it or the dock on a point with a large boat in it or a metal boat lift. I am using 1/16 or 1/32 oz grub and shooting it back in to the deepest darkest hole I can find. One note on this is when I am not on the water I practice dock shooting by shooting through the legs of a lawn chair in to a five gallon bucket.
